Description

Confuse is a configuration library for Python that uses YAML. It takes care of defaults, overrides, type checking, command-line integration, human-readable errors, and standard OS-specific locations. - sensible API resembling dictionary-and-list structures but providing transparent validation without lots of boilerplate - combine configuration data from multiple sources - look for configuration files in platform-specific paths - integration with command-line arguments via 'argparse'_ or 'optparse'
